## Local Setup

The Ledgerlens audit-log viewer needs Node 20 and a local copy of the `audit_events` schema. Run `make seed` to load sample events, then `make dev` to start the viewer on port 4180. Filters and export both work offline against the seed data. Before starting, point the app at your local database using the connection string below.

replica DSN, kajep-yahag: mssql://praok_svc:iF@db-8d68.plorvaio.local:5432/eliion

Handover for reception, Larkspindle House: the spare-hardware storage room is on the mezzanine, second door past the printers. It holds replacement laptops, cables, and headsets — please log anything removed in the blue binder on the shelf inside. Keep the door shut; it doesn't latch on its own. The keypad code is below.

badge for fafop-fajof: bdg-Z-47

## Authentication

The StockMend reconciliation job authenticates against the Ledgerwell inventory API before each nightly run. If the job fails with a 401, do not restart it blindly: check that the service account has not been rotated out by the Quorix scheduler first. Tokens are scoped read-write to the reconciliation namespace only, and expire every twelve hours, so stale pages in the runbook may show old values. For manual reruns from the on-call host, use the token below.

session JWT of yawep-yawep = eyJhbGciOiJIUzI1NiIsInR5cCI6IkpXVCJ9.eyJzdWIiOiI3pWF3_In0.aXYsHiog

# Break-Glass: Catalog Cache Invalidation

Scope: the Pinrow product catalog at Veldstone Retail. If stale prices persist after a purge and the Hollowmere invalidation queue is wedged, use break-glass to flush the edge tier directly. Contractors: get verbal sign-off from the catalog lead first. Steps: open the Hollowmere admin shell, select emergency-flush, confirm the tenant, and run it once — repeated flushes thrash the origin. Access is logged and expires after 20 minutes. Unseal the admin shell with the passphrase below.

recovery phrase for kahop-tajog: istix-casvan